Chapter 31 Liuhe Spear
Xia Qing couldn't help but feel anxious as she waited for Grandpa Zhang for a long time.
If he were just a stranger, he wouldn't be so sentimental and blame everything on himself.
However, Zhang Hai and Grandpa Zhang had received money and he had promised to go and resolve the matter.
If someone dies because of one's absence, then one cannot escape blame, both morally and logically.
"Excuse me, does anyone know where Grandpa Zhang lives? He's the one who used to practice Tai Chi here."
After a moment's thought, Xia Qing decided to take the initiative.
He will feel uneasy if he doesn't address this issue.
Moreover, whether it's stimulating the awakening of martial arts skills or hunting nightmares to obtain the origin, this matter is beneficial and harmless.
"Old Zhang? We're usually familiar with each other, but I've never actually asked where he lives..."
"It seems like he doesn't live here. I always see him being picked up and dropped off by car..."
With Xia Qing's 'master' level reputation here, he naturally has no shortage of responses.
Unfortunately, I was unable to get their contact information in the end.
Most of the elderly people who frequent this area know Old Zhang, but he doesn't live nearby.
His relationship with everyone was like that of a professional friend. Although they were familiar with each other during their daily morning exercise, few people actually bothered to find out his background. If asked for his name and address, no one could answer.
"There's nothing I can do about it."
Thus, Xia Qing sighed and could only tell Grandpa Zhang and the others to pray for their own good fortune.
Regardless, life must go on.
After instructing Xu Dashan for a while, Xia Qing sent him away. He then focused his mind and cleared his thoughts, and together with Old Li, they practiced Iron Head Kung Fu by crashing into trees.
But when it comes to this skill, even Old Li doesn't seem to have a method. He's just been hitting trees, and over time, he's gradually become tough and resilient.
However, these hard skills are basically all like this, relying on the slow and steady process of physical injury and self-healing.
After practicing for a while, Xia Qing felt she couldn't take it anymore and had to stop.
But instead of resting, he sought out an old man who practiced wielding a large spear.
Unlike Iron Head Kung Fu, which relies purely on adaptation, this spear technique has many intricacies and cannot be mastered without a teacher's guidance.
The old man practicing his spear-shaking technique clearly possesses considerable skill. His spear, over three meters long, is so powerful that even a normal person couldn't lift it horizontally due to the leverage principle.
This old man could hold the pole by the end with one hand, raise it horizontally, block and strike, and swing it with great force.
It's hard to judge his performance in actual combat, but his skill level is definitely not lacking; it's clear he's been immersed in the field for many years.
Hero Park is home to quite a few hidden talents like this.
"Sir, what's the secret to your marksmanship? Does it have a name?"
Xia Qing watched from the sidelines for a while, then tried to approach her to strike up a conversation and ask for her advice.
"The Eight Extremes Spear, also known as the Eight Extremes Six Harmonies Spear."
Although the old man who practiced shooting had been practicing on his own and hadn't learned boxing from Xia Qing like the others, the place was so small that he naturally recognized Xia Qing.
The voice wasn't particularly enthusiastic, but it wasn't cold either.
"Oh? The old man is actually a successor of Bajiquan?"
Xia Qing's eyes lit up.
Since his own abilities were inextricably linked to martial arts, he naturally did some research on the relevant information.
Wen has Taiji to stabilize the world, and Wu has Baji to stabilize the world.
Although this statement is mostly a misinterpretation, its original meaning actually refers to terms related to the I Ching rather than two martial arts styles.
However, this did not prevent Tai Chi and Bajiquan from being compared by enthusiasts and gaining widespread fame.
But when it comes to actual combat, Bajiquan is far more famous than Tai Chi.
The Baji Liuhe Spear is a spear technique that is part of Bajiquan (Eight Extremities Fist).
This is very common in Xia Kingdom martial arts, where the vast majority of boxing techniques are accompanied by weapon usage techniques that are inherited from the same lineage.
After all, when it comes to fighting, fists are no match for sharp blades, and those who practiced martial arts in the past weren't stupid.
"What's this talk about passing on skills to others? These days, if you want to learn, you can pay tuition and learn anywhere." Grandpa Baji maintained his indifferent attitude.
"Then... is there a way to avoid paying?"
Xia Qing coughed lightly.
Everything else is negotiable.
I don't have any money...
Although not much of the 18,000 yuan in the account was actually used, the extravagant spending had damaged his fortune, and it was only a matter of time before he lost it all.
Debts at this causal level will only trigger a stronger chain reaction, and absolutely cannot be touched.
All he has left to use are a few hundred yuan.
"You want to learn?"
Grandpa Baji glanced at Xia Qing, finally finished his set of moves, and stood still with his spear.
"I want to learn, but I don't have the money."
Xia Qing confessed sincerely.
"If you want to learn, here, hold the butt of the gun and lift it up with one hand."
Grandpa Baji threw over a spear that was more than three meters long.
Xia Qing reached out and caught it, and tried as instructed.
It was quite difficult when I first tried it.
The entire spear was already quite heavy, and holding only one end due to the leverage principle made it feel even heavier.
Fortunately, after undergoing dual physical enhancement through Tai Chi Chuan and Money Dart techniques, his current physical condition is definitely outstanding among ordinary people, and he also has a solid foundation in generating power.
"rise!"
Xia Qing gripped the butt of the gun, spun it around, and held it horizontally, where it remained motionless in mid-air.
"Good! I didn't realize this young man actually had some skill!"
When the Eight Great Elders saw Xia Qing's move, their eyes lit up, and they were no longer the indifferent people they had been before.
He usually just did morning exercises here, so he never saw Xia Qing practice his boxing for real that first time.
Hearing that the exercise was Tai Chi, and that everyone was calling him "Master," he naturally assumed they were just fake masters who were ruining the reputation of traditional Chinese martial arts.
Unexpectedly, this casual display of skill revealed his true mastery.
Everything else can be faked, but pure power and the exertion of force cannot be faked.
"The most essential technique in marksmanship is simply thrusting. If you can thrust accurately, quickly, and fiercely, then you've achieved a minor level of proficiency in marksmanship."
Grandpa Baji got excited and pointed to a small bottle cap hanging not far ahead, saying, "Come on, puncture that bottle cap."
"Row."
For Xia Qing, this was child's play.
The essence of the Money Dart technique lies in its combination of power and accuracy.
He directly regarded the spear as a special long spear, pretended to throw it, and then transformed the throw into a thrust.
laugh!
A single shot, like a dragon emerging from the sea, easily pierced the bottle cap.
You should know that this bottle cap is so small and wobbly that it doesn't bear any force when suspended in the air.
As for that three-meter-long spear, even if an ordinary person could barely lift it, their hands would tremble uncontrollably.
Xia Qing's casual shot was so skillful, a perfect combination of power and technique, truly exquisite.
"You little punk, you've got training, huh? Trying to make fun of me."
The Eight Extremes Grandfather blew his beard and glared.
"No, really. I've just practiced some other martial arts, so I guess you could say I've learned a bit from other styles."
Xia Qing sighed and explained, then looked at him again: "Grandpa, what should we do next?"
